Heim  >  Artikel  >  Backend-Entwicklung  >  Implementierung einer Echtzeit-Technologie zur Verarbeitung genetischer Daten mithilfe von PHP

Implementierung einer Echtzeit-Technologie zur Verarbeitung genetischer Daten mithilfe von PHP

WBOY
WBOYOriginal
2023-06-28 08:17:261097Durchsuche

Mit der Entwicklung der Biotechnologie ist die Generierung und Verarbeitung genetischer Daten für Wissenschaftler zunehmend zu einem wichtigen Forschungsgebiet geworden, um die Geheimnisse des Lebens zu entschlüsseln. Die rasante Entwicklung der Datenverarbeitungstechnologie beschleunigt auch die Erfassung und Analyse genetischer Daten. In diesem Artikel wird erläutert, wie Sie mithilfe von PHP die Technologie zur Verarbeitung genetischer Daten in Echtzeit implementieren.

1. Überblick über die genetische Datenverarbeitungstechnologie

Die genetische Datenverarbeitung umfasst mehrere Disziplinen wie Bioinformatik, Informatik und Statistik. Die Hauptaufgabe besteht darin, genetische Daten zu analysieren und zu interpretieren und wichtige Informationen für die Forschung im Bereich der Biowissenschaften bereitzustellen.

Die Verarbeitung von Gendaten kann in drei Schritte unterteilt werden: Beschaffung genetischer Daten, Verarbeitung genetischer Daten und Analyse genetischer Daten. Die Gewinnung genetischer Daten erfordert den Einsatz verschiedener Technologien wie Gensequenzierung, Gelelektrophorese, PCR-Amplifikation usw. Die Verarbeitung und Analyse genetischer Daten erfordert den Einsatz verschiedener Algorithmen und Tools.

Mit der kontinuierlichen Weiterentwicklung der Computertechnologie und Biotechnologie wurden auch die Verarbeitungsgeschwindigkeit und Effizienz genetischer Daten erheblich verbessert. Zu den derzeit häufig verwendeten Tools zur Verarbeitung genetischer Daten gehören BLAST, Bowtie, Samtools usw., die hauptsächlich auf der Sprache C++, Java oder Python basieren.

2. PHP implementiert genetische Datenverarbeitungstechnologie in Echtzeit.

PHP ist eine in der Webentwicklung weit verbreitete Skriptsprache, kann aber auch einige Datenverarbeitungs- und Rechenaufgaben bewältigen. PHP ist einfach zu erlernen und zu verwenden und kann problemlos in Verbindung mit der MySQL-Datenbank verwendet werden. Daher kann PHP in einigen spezifischen Szenarien auch als Sprache für die Verarbeitung genetischer Daten verwendet werden.

Das Folgende ist ein Beispiel, das zeigt, wie PHP zur Implementierung einer datenbankbasierten genetischen Datenanalyse verwendet wird:

// Mit der Datenbank verbinden
$conn = mysqli_connect("localhost", "username", "password", "genedatabase" );

// Alle Gene abrufen
$result = mysqli_query($conn, "SELECT * FROM genes");

// Die Zählvariable initialisieren
$total_genes = 0;

// Schleife zur Verarbeitung jedes Genes

while ($row = mysqli_fetch_assoc($result)) {
$total_genes++;
$total_length += strlen($row['sequence']);
}

// Ergebnisse ausgeben

echo "Total Genes: „ Gendatenbank und Abfrage genetischer Informationen. Anschließend wird jedes Gen durchlaufen und die durchschnittliche Genlänge berechnet. Abschließend werden die Ergebnisse ausgegeben.

Dies ist nur ein einfaches Beispiel für die PHP-Implementierung der Echtzeit-Technologie zur Verarbeitung genetischer Daten. Tatsächlich kann PHP verschiedene Algorithmen und Tools kombinieren, um eine komplexere und effizientere Verarbeitung genetischer Daten zu erreichen.

3. Herausforderungen und Perspektiven der genetischen Datenverarbeitung

Die schnelle Entwicklung der genetischen Datenverarbeitungstechnologie ist äußerst wichtig für den Fortschritt der biowissenschaftlichen Forschung. Die Verarbeitung genetischer Daten steht jedoch immer noch vor vielen Herausforderungen, wie z. B. großen Datenmengen, Rauschstörungen und inkonsistenter Datenqualität.

Mit der Weiterentwicklung der Technologie sind die Aussichten für die Verarbeitung genetischer Daten immer noch sehr groß. In Zukunft werden die Menschen weiterhin verschiedene Probleme im Verarbeitungsprozess genetischer Daten verbessern und optimieren, um ihn genauer und effizienter zu machen. Darüber hinaus werden immer mehr Technologien entwickelt und eingesetzt, um immer größere und komplexere genetische Daten zu verarbeiten.

Kurz gesagt ist die Implementierung von Echtzeit-Technologie zur Verarbeitung genetischer Daten mit PHP ein interessantes und herausforderndes Gebiet. Durch kontinuierliche Verbesserung und Erforschung haben wir Grund zu der Annahme, dass die Technologie zur Verarbeitung genetischer Daten in der zukünftigen Life-Science-Forschung eine immer wichtigere Rolle spielen wird.

Das obige ist der detaillierte Inhalt vonImplementierung einer Echtzeit-Technologie zur Verarbeitung genetischer Daten mithilfe von P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n